com.android.ddmlib
Interfaces 
AndroidDebugBridge.IClientChangeListener
AndroidDebugBridge.IDebugBridgeChangeListener
AndroidDebugBridge.IDeviceChangeListener
ClientData.IHprofDumpHandler
ClientData.IMethodProfilingHandler
DebugPortManager.IDebugPortProvider
FileListingService.IListingReceiver
IDevice
IShellOutputReceiver
IStackTraceInfo
Log.ILogOutput
SyncService.ISyncProgressMonitor
Classes 
AllocationInfo
AllocationInfo.AllocationSorter
AndroidDebugBridge
Client
ClientData
ClientData.HeapData
CollectingOutputReceiver
DdmConstants
DdmPreferences
DebugPortManager
EmulatorConsole
EmulatorConsole.GsmStatus
EmulatorConsole.NetworkStatus
FileListingService
FileListingService.FileEntry
HeapSegment
HeapSegment.HeapSegmentElement
Log
MultiLineReceiver
NativeAllocationInfo
NativeLibraryMapInfo
NativeStackCallInfo
NullOutputReceiver
RawImage
SyncService
ThreadInfo
Enums 
AllocationInfo.SortMode
ClientData.AllocationTrackingStatus
ClientData.DebuggerStatus
ClientData.MethodProfilingStatus
EmulatorConsole.GsmMode
IDevice.DeviceState
Log.LogLevel
SyncException.SyncError
Exceptions 
AdbCommandRejectedException
CanceledException
InstallException
ShellCommandUnresponsiveException
SyncException
TimeoutException